  1. How I started to earn even before the completion of my education! How I start I am pursuing a graduate degree and belong to a lower middle class family. I feel very proud and grateful to my parents that they have always encouraged me to pursue higher education despite of the fact that most of the girls in our caste are married off as early as 16-18 years. However, I watch my parents sacrificing their own wishes and desires to support my education. I did not actually want to put the burden of my education expenses on them. I offered to do ad hoc jobs but my parents were strictly against it. I was upset. I neither could see them working so hard nor could I do anything but study.Yes, I was good at studies and was getting good marks for their satisfaction. For that was the only thing I could do to make them happy. Two months passed. One day, I saw my friend doing something on the internet. I asked her what she was doing. She said that she was uploading the photos of her mom’s handmade jewellery on a website. When I asked her further queries, I came to know that her mom has joined a platform named Pink Desk that is only for women where she could sell her jewellery. She could reach the customers from nearby areas through that website. I asked her if we have to pay any charges for joining the platform. When she replied that it is all free; bells started ringing in my mind. I immediately learned and registered on the website. Then I met my friend’s mom and asked her if she could give me a chance to sell her jewellery on a commission basis in my area which was far away from her place. Seeing the opportunity of getting customers base she agreed with me. And then my journey began. I created my store for my location on ‘Mandi’, a local marketplace on Pink Desk and started uploading photos of the jewellery. I am getting good response and many customers have started visiting me already. I often organize exhibition on Sunday’s where I can meet all the customers at once. I can now manage to take care of my personal expenses and have also started saving for my exam fees! While most of the girls of my age spend their time chatting with random boys on Facebook, I spend my time on my store on PinkDesk and replying to customer queries.

  2. My parents are happy too as I don’t have to stay away from home for longer hours and they don’t have to worry about my safety. We are all thankful to my friend’s mom who gave me this opportunity. I feel I have been lucky that I have set on a path of Entrepreneurship early in my life and while most of my friends and classmates are still not sure what they want from life, atleast I know where am I heading. So, if you want to be a self-sufficient person, you don’t have to really wait till completion of your education. There are ways where you can earn without affecting your studies.
